Manufacturer's description

AeroShell Grease 33 is a universal synthetic airframe grease composed of a lithium complex thickener and synthetic base oils, with oxidation and corrosion inhibitor and load carrying additives. For use in the temperature range –73 0C to +121 0C.

Applications

  • For many years, aircraft operators have sought to rationalise the greases used on board aircraft and to reduce the number of different greases in their inventories. Recently, Boeing began researching a new multi-purpose, anti-corrosion grease. The aim was for a clay-free grease that would give longer life to components and mechanisms and that would have improved wear and corrosion resistance. This led to the introduction of a new Boeing specification, BMS 3-33B.
  • Given the wide range of operating temperatures, loads and other environmental conditions required for different aircraft components, many different types of grease, with different properties, are used in the routine lubrication of aircraft components. In developing their BMS 3-33B specification, Boeing considered the properties of the various grease types used for aircraft and wrote a specification for a grease that would deliver improved performance and could be used across the widest possible range of grease applications.
  • AeroShell Grease 33 is approved to BMS 3-33B and delivers the improved performance characteristics required by that specification.
  • AeroShell Grease 33 can be used for routine lubrication on Boeing aircraft where MIL-PRF-23827C or BMS 3-24 is specified. AeroShell Grease 33 can also be used in certain applications on Boeing aircraft that require the use of MIL-G-21164. Other applications on Boeing aircraft requiring the use of MIL-G-21164 and other greases are under review, and in due course Boeing will issue details of the full range of applications. For the current status, consult the latest issue of the Boeing Service Letter "BMS 3-33B General Purpose Aircraft Grease".
  • AeroShell Grease 33 can be used for routine lubrication in applications where MIL-PRF-23827C is specified on aircraft produced by McDonnell Douglas, Airbus, BAe Regional Aircraft, Canadair, Lockheed, Embraer, Fokker and Gulfstream (except for bearings, applications above 121 0 C and sliding applications requiring molybdenum disulphide).
  • Other aircraft manufacturers are evaluating AeroShell Grease 33 with a view to using the approvals for their aircraft. Operators should check regularly with these manufacturers for the latest status.
  • The use of AeroShell Grease 33 can provide operators with the following benefits:
  • Reduced inventories; reduced maintenance and labour costs; fewer opportunities for misapplication of the product.
